NEWS FLASH – DMC Threads posted on Linkedin that they have bought Anchor thread !!!! The two lines will continue to be separate as DMC says it will take a year to transition Anchor into their line up. The previous owner will stay on to help with the transition and manage the brand. DMC wants to be the #1 needlecraft brand. DMC

Tips and Tricks: From Diversions Needlepoint in CO – suggestions for when you are stitching a dark color on dark canvas – an eye killer ! 1. Stitch outside if you can – daylight shows the canvas intersections better. 2. Use the best indoor lighting you can. 3. Use a magnifier. 4. use a light or very bright color cloth under your stitching – the color comes thru the canvas and makes the holes easier to see. 5. The pattern of a decorative stitch will assist in directing the stitcher to the next stitch location on a dark canvas.

Planet Earth has a new thread – Milan – it’s a 50/50 blend of silk and merino wool. It comes in 30 yard skeins and is a single strand thread. It is a bit thicker so it covers on both 18 and 13 count. They say it’s luxuriously soft to stitch with. KC Needlepoint is carrying the entire line and it’s in stock. https://www.kcneedlepoint.com/collections/milan?page=1

Tips and Tricks How do we protect and store our “small” stash of canvases until we use them – I had a hard time with that word small ! LOL According to Diversions Needlepoint –

 let’s consider what we are trying to protect when storing needlepoint canvases. Of course, we need to protect the painted design, but an equally important consideration is the protection of the canvas sizing. Sizing is what keeps canvases firm. The better the condition of sizing at the end of a project, the better the finished product will be. This is why we recommend using stretcher bars, by the way! Quite right, Willie! Any dampness or creases will break down canvas sizing, much to the detriment of the piece.

Here is what we paws to consider when storing our needlepoint stash:

Environment: Temperate, dry, away from direct light, No attics or damp basements. No smokey or smelly hidey holes.

Canvas Form: Rolled or flat, NEVER FOLDED. Folds will break down the sizing and show up in the finished piece.

Container: Waterproof plastic bins or cloth sacks (old pillow cases?) stored on elevated shelves away from water sources. Never airtight containers: a canvas needs to breathe so that mold can’t develop.

Preventative measures: Silica gel packs. These are the annoying little desiccant packets that have fallen out of every Amazon package ever opened.

New Books coming – Mary’s Whimsical Small Stitches – her 4th and newest in her series will start shipping in June. Inspired By Threads is out with a 3rd revision of the original Threads book. A 157 page reference book detailing who makes each thread, what it is made of, how you should use it and tips about stitching with it. There are also ideas and details on how much thread you need for a project. You can get this book thru Homestead Needle Arts https://www.homesteadneedlearts.com/catalog/books-charts-cds-magazines/inspired-by-threads-revised-3rd-edition-of-threads-a-needle-necessity-book/ and Mary’s Small Stitches can only be purchased at your LNS.
